    HANKOOK 24H DUBAI
    Three-day event beginning on Thursday 12 January, Friday 13, Saturday 14

    The Hankook 24-hour endurance race is an adrenaline-packed weekend that sees the world’s best endurance racers descend on the Dubai Autodrome.

    And the FIA-approved event – which began in 2006 – is set to wow UAE petrolheads again.

    Spectators in Dubai will witness the excitement unravel at the state-of-the-art Dubai Autodrome in Motor City, with crowd favourite Khaled Al Qubaisi set to grace the track along with former Formula One driver Robert Kubica.

    The Emirati driver maintains high hopes of erasing previous heartbreaks to claim victory for a third time – having triumphed in 2012 and 2013. He enjoyed a successful stint in Mexico with Abu Dhabi-Proton Racing in 2016 and will certainly be among the favourites for glory again.

    RACE 2 ADCB ZAYED SPORTS CITY 5K AND 10K RUN
    Friday, 13 January 

    The second and third Zayed Sports City runs are open to people of various fitness levels with previous editions welcoming everyone from toddlers to 70-year-olds!

    It’s a sensible idea for novice runners to take part in the 5km fun run, which consists of a single circuit of the Zayed Sports City grounds. For those keen to further test their endurance, the 10km run requires participants to complete two laps.

    Contestants who reach the finishing line receive medals, their official race time and a running cap.

    MEYDAN HORSE RACES – DAY 6
    Saturday, 14 January

    Witness UAE racing action at its finest at Meydan Racecourse.

    Fun fact: the Meydan Racecourse grandstand is the world’s longest single structure, boasting an incredible reach of over a mile in length. It is capable of accommodating over 60,000 spectators and that’s exactly what the venue does for the Dubai World Cup each year.

    Before that, however, there is a season of racing to enjoy. Dubai is well known for it’s passion for horse-racing given the success of the world-renowned Godolphin stable, and each Thursday night from November onwards, Meydan host nights of horse racing for fans and newcomers alike to enjoy.

    General admission is free but there are also hospitality packages to suit a special occasion.
